Cindy Sherman Unmasked

That tantalizing sense of mystery and uneasiness are similar emotions viewers feel when they see one of Ms. Sherman's elliptical photographs. Over the course of her remarkable 35-year career she has transformed herself into hundreds of different personas: the movie star, the valley girl, the angry housewife, the frustrated socialite, the Renaissance courtesan, the menacing clown, even the Roman god Bacchus.

A daily form of masquerade that communicates culture, gender and class, has been a constant source of inspiration for Sherman.  Fashion  - History - Detris - are the subject matter of Cindy Sherman's theatrical pictures.  Outlandish and revolting tableau's equally repulsive and seductive become visually rich 'landscapes'; painterly textured and colored. 

For nearly 40 years, photographer Cindy Sherman's been her own model, muse, makeup artist and stylist. Now, she's her own plastic surgeon, too.

Working digitally, she can play with her image in ways she couldn't before - narrow her eyes, elongate her nose and thin or thicken her lips. And instead of one Sherman per frame, we can get multiples - doubling or tripling the pleasure of this inimitably mutable artist.
